Whole-Home Repairs Act of 2024
The Whole-Home Repairs Act of 2024 establishes a $25 million pilot program to fund home repairs for low-income homeowners and landlords. Eligible homeowners (with income at or below 80% of area median income who own and occupy their homes) would receive grants for repairs addressing accessibility, safety, and energy efficiency. Eligible landlords (owning fewer than 10 rental properties with a majority of affordable units) would receive forgivable loans for similar repairs, with requirements to maintain affordability for three years. The pilot program would operate until 2029, requiring implementing organizations to coordinate with existing housing programs and submit annual reports on program outcomes.
